N For Norukkals

Thattu Vadai, Norukkals & more 4.5

Pudupet Road

  • 30 Mins
    Delivery time
  • 2:00 pm - 8:00 pm
    Closed
  • Closed for Delivery

    This restaurant currently not accepting orders